Beyond Paris

2005 is a significant year in the international efforts to achieve the MDGs. Following the Millennium Summit, the international community planned to reconvene in 2005 to look at progress toward the Millennium Development Goals. Participants at Monterrey (2002) agreed to review the consensus in 2005. The Rome High-Level Forum on Harmonization (2003) agreed to have a follow-up stocktaking meeting in 2005. At the Marrakech Roundtable on Managing for Results (2004), participants were encouraged to seek their agencies' and governments' support for the action plan in 2005. In London, England, on January 13-14, 2005, the Department for International Development, the European Commission, OECD-DAC, UNDP, and the World Bank cosponsored a Senior-Level Forum on Development Effectiveness in Fragile States. Also, the Civil Society Organization (CSO) Forum on Aid Effectiveness and Harmonisation was hosted by the French Haut Conseil de la Coopération internationale (HCCI), February 3, 2005, in Paris. Both of these meetings yielded findings and messages that informed the deliberations in Paris.

Thus the year 2005 has been planned to focus international high-level attention on these issues in an interconnected way-what progress is being made on meeting explicit targets for MDGs; how much more aid is needed; how it should be delivered; and how it can be managed for better development results. Nobody could have predicted that the Paris Forum discussions would take place against the backdrop of a tsunami and the global effort to deal with its aftermath. But the unprecedented scale of global humanitarian assistance being provided in the wake of the disaster has served to underline the critical importance of effective delivery and management of aid even under crisis conditions. The uniqueness of 2005 therefore makes it a time for action.
